Olá, Pessoal!
Estou tentando eliminar os acentos e símbolos nos nomes,
de acordo com uma tabela de duas colunas; bem como,
a inicial maiúscula nos termos de ligação desses nomes,
quando a opção "NA" (na cél D2) for selecionada na planilha anexa.
planilha-modelo.xls
Porém, o Excel estabelece um limite nos níveis de aninhamento
na fórmula, ficando de fora a maioria dos acentos ou símbolos.
E a minha fórmula, abaixo, não está deixando em minúscula os termos de ligação.
=SE(D2="AT";
CONCATENAR(A2;MAIÚSCULA(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(B2;"Á";"A");"Â";"A");"Ã";"A");"Ç";"C");"É";"E"));" ";C2;" ";D2;E2);
CONCATENAR(A2;PRI.MAIÚSCULA(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(SUBSTITUIR(B2;" Da ";" da ");" De ";" de ");" Do ";" do ");"á";"a");"â";"a"));" ";C2;" ";D2;E2))
Grato pela atenção,
Orlando Souza
🧐
PS: Se a resposta foi útil, clique na "mãozinha positiva" ou em "curtir" na fonte de link informada, agradecendo ao colaborador do código/fórmula. Eu já fiz a minha parte! :]
Postado : 01/02/2021 7:40 pm